From 4:40 - 5:15 p.m. today (12/25/13) 6-7 Short-eared Owls were active on
or near the Lorain Cty. Airport. They could be seen hunting on both sides
of Russia Rd. - over the airport grounds to the north, and on the ag lands
to the south. Also on both sides of Oberlin Rd. immediately north of
Russia Rd.
Several offered very good views perched on the perimeter fence of the
airport. Considering how much more habitat exists within the airport that
we didn't scan, more owls are probably wintering there.
